The Truth About Playing Without Showing Your ID: What No KYC Casinos Actually Offer

The appeal is obvious: skip the documents, dodge the waiting, and start playing immediately. No KYC casinos strip away the usual identity checks entirely during registration, letting you fund your account and hit the slots in minutes rather than hours. But here’s the thing – “no verification” doesn’t mean no rules, no checks, or no accountability. It just means the gatekeeping happens later, if at all.

What Really Happens When You Skip Verification

These platforms flip the traditional script. Instead of demanding a driver’s license or passport right off the bat, they let you register with just a username, email, and payment info. The identity check – if it ever comes – only triggers during large withdrawals or when regulatory flags pop up. For most casual play, you stay anonymous.

This setup isn’t lawlessness. Every reputable platform still holds a license, encrypts your data, and tests games for fairness. The difference is speed and privacy. You’re trading upfront bureaucracy for a quieter system that only asks for proof when it absolutely needs to.

The Catch Nobody Talks About

That streamlined registration isn’t permanent invisibility. If you win big – and I mean life-changing big – the platform will request verification before releasing funds. This isn’t a trick. It’s regulatory obligation. No licensed casino can legally hand over a massive payout without confirming you’re who you say you are, under anti-money laundering laws.

Also, because the barrier to entry is lower, you need self-discipline more than ever. Deposit limits, session timers, and self-exclusion tools exist on these sites, but nobody forces you to use them. Without a verification wall slowing you down, the responsibility sits squarely on your own habits.

How to Pick One That Won’t Burn You

Don’t fall for the “zero verification” pitch alone. Look for:

Licensing. Curacao, Malta, or UK Gambling Commission – any of these beats no license at all. Encryption. SSL on the login and payment pages, visible as the padlock icon. Fair testing. Look for RNG certifications from eCOGRA or iTech Labs. Withdrawal history. Check forums for real player reports on payout speed and behavior around big wins.

If a site doesn’t publish its terms clearly or hides its licensing details, walk. The whole point of no KYC is convenience, not an escape from accountability.
